Default Who was closer to the Triple Crown...Smarty or Alex?

I'm guessing some here will think this is a ridiculous question.

In 2004, Smarty Jones won the Derby, Preakness, and then lost by one length to Birdstone, falling just short of winning the elusive Triple Crown.

In 2005, Afleet Alex lost The Kentucky Derby by 1 1/2 lengths, and then won the Preakness and Belmont easily.

I realize I am being a Monday Morning quarterback, but in those two scenarios, which horse was closest to winning the Triple Crown?

On one hand Smarty led until the very end of the Belmont. Could his jockey have done something to run a better race or was that truly an effort of everything Smarty had to give.

On the other hand, did Jeremy Rose run the best race he could of with Alex in the Derby? Of course Jeremy Rose redeemed himself in the Preakness for matching AA's superb athleticism when they clipped heels with Scrappy T.

So again, my question is Who was closer to winning the Triple Crown or which horse could have won the Triple Crown?
